Output 80ece34168cb72540cf4763b4d2f090717bd4e41f3a71fe9fd7a895ca67fd1fb:0

value
51673
script pubkey
OP_0 OP_PUSHBYTES_20 08e80a2392793906fb49d597ec05fc3bac09f011
address
bc1qpr5q5guj0yusd76f6kt7cp0u8wkqnuq34fwn5a
transaction
80ece34168cb72540cf4763b4d2f090717bd4e41f3a71fe9fd7a895ca67fd1fb
confirmations
342947
spent
true